What is the Access to Learning Support for Inpatients?
The Access to Learning Support for Inpatients is an essential form designed to facilitate education support for students who are hospitalized. This form enables healthcare providers to communicate educational needs effectively, ensuring that students do not fall behind in their studies during their hospital stay. It is primarily used by healthcare professionals, educators, and parents, particularly when a child’s hospitalization impacts their regular learning schedule.

Who Needs the Access to Learning Support for Inpatients?
-
Students admitted to hospitals requiring educational assistance.
-
Teachers, who play a vital role in guiding the educational support process.
-
Health Professionals, who must validate the student's need for support.
-
Allied Health professionals involved in the student's medical care.
The form needs signatures from designated professionals, including educators and health practitioners, to confirm the educational requirements and support necessary during hospitalization.
Eligibility Criteria for Access to Learning Support for Inpatients
To qualify for the Access to Learning Support for Inpatients, several eligibility criteria must be met. Students must be enrolled in an educational institution and be currently hospitalized. Documentation from healthcare providers outlining the student’s condition is typically required. Furthermore, specific conditions related to the student’s health may dictate the support they are eligible for, as outlined in their hospital education plan.
